Title: Apple unleashes M3 series of chips at its Scary Fast special event
Post by: Redaktion on October 31, 2023, 02:49:36
Apple has unveiled its M3 series chips, promising significant performance and efficiency improvements over its predecessors. The upgrades to the GPU are particularly remarkable, which now supports hardware-accelerated Ray Tracing and a new feature Apple calls 'Dynamic Caching'.
